What Are Biennials?

Alright, here's the scoop: biennial plants take their sweet time to reach full maturity. In their first year, they’re all about growing roots, stems, and leaves—no flowers in sight. This initial stage is crucial as the plant stores up energy like a squirrel hoarding nuts for winter. Think of it as a solid foundation; you wouldn't build a house without one, right? This first-year phase is all about strength—roots gripping the soil, leaves soaking up sunlight, and stems reaching for the sky.

Then, in their second year, biennials really make a splash! They transition from being wallflowers to the life of the garden party, blossoming into glorious flowers, then producing seeds before the final curtain call—dying off to make way for new life. This two-year act sets them apart in the plant kingdom!

What About Other Plant Types?

Now, you might be scratching your head, wondering how biennials stack up against their plant cousins. Let’s break it down:

  • Annuals: These guys are the speedsters of the plant world! They germinate, grow, flower, and die—all in a single growing season. Talk about living life in the fast lane!

  • Perennials: Unlike the one-hit wonders of annuals, perennials play the long game. They can live for multiple seasons, returning each spring, sometimes with even more flowers than the last. They’re like that reliable friend who's always there, season after season.

  • Grasses: Now, this one's a bit tricky. Grasses can be either annual or perennial, but they don’t strictly fit into the two-year life cycle category like biennials. They have their own unique adaptations that can help them thrive in various environments.

The Importance of Understanding Plant Life Cycles

Knowing how biennial plants function is important for various reasons, especially in pest management. Understanding the growth cycle of plants helps you make better decisions when it comes to applying pest control strategies. For example, timing is everything—applying treatments while biennials are in their vegetative phase might have different implications than during their flowering stage. Plus, the right timing can help you protect not only these plants but also the broader ecosystem, ensuring you’re fostering a healthy environment for beneficial insects and wildlife.
